Understanding Simulated Forex Trading

In the dynamic world of finance, simulated forex trading has emerged as a vital tool for traders and investors seeking to hone their skills without the risks associated with real-money trading. This approach allows participants to practice trading strategies in a risk-free environment by using virtual currency. Such simulations can mirror the volatile nature of the forex market, enabling individuals and businesses to understand the market's intricacies.

Key Features of Simulated Forex Trading Platforms

To optimize your experience, it's essential to select a simulated forex trading platform that offers comprehensive features. Here are some key aspects to consider:

  • Real-Time Data: Access to live market feeds provides realistic trading conditions.
  • User-Friendly Interface: An intuitive interface enhances the learning curve, especially for beginners.
  • Variety of Instruments: A good platform should offer a range of currency pairs and derivatives to simulate different trading strategies.
  • Performance Analytics: Detailed reports and analytics help users understand their performance and adjust their strategies accordingly.

Advantages of Simulated Forex Trading for Investors

For individual investors, the benefits of engaging in simulated forex trading go beyond merely practicing with virtual funds. Some key advantages include:

  • No Financial Risk: Trading with virtual money eliminates the fear of loss, enabling users to focus entirely on learning.
  • Time Flexibility: Simulated platforms often allow users to trade at their own pace, accommodating busy schedules.
  • Enhanced Confidence: With consistent practice, investors can build confidence before committing real resources.

How to Get Started with Simulated Forex Trading

Interested in diving into the world of simulated forex trading?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you begin:

1. Choose a Suitable Trading Platform

Start by researching and selecting a non-restrictive, reliable trading platform that offers good simulated trading options.

2. Create an Account

Sign up for a demo account. Most platforms provide an easy registration process that can be completed in minutes.

3. Explore the Features

Familiarize yourself with the platform's interface, tools, and features. Understanding how to navigate the platform is critical for effective learning.

4. Start Trading!

Begin trading with your virtual funds. Apply your strategies, analyze results, and continuously refine your approach.
